I applied two months ago and will be starting work in late august. I actually only received one reply to my application, but I did email the secretaries and PIs of about a dozen other labs I was interested in and told them that was applying to be an IRTA and wanted to be considered for a position in their labs. Ended up going with the one lab that responded to my original application. On the other hand, I have two friends who applied and received 5 or 6 replies within a week.. even before their recommendations were in.

If you've been waiting for awhile, I would suggest going through the list of researchers on the NIH website and emailing the PIs AND secretaries of labs that you'd like to work with. Also, if they don't reply within a few days, email them again.. it sounds annoying, but some labs won't even consider replying until you've emailed twice.
